WebJan 11, 2012 · Many carbohydrates can undergo fermentation in the presence of yeast. The carbohydrate is the food source for the yeast, and the products of the fermentation reaction are ethanol and carbon dioxide gas. WebThere are several types of biological macromolecules: Carbohydrates, Proteins, Lipids and Nucleic acids. All macromolecules, except lipids, are polymers. A polymer is a long molecule composed of chains of monomers. Monomers are small molecules that serve as building blocks of polymers. WebJul 30, 2024 · Counting carbohydrates. Many foods contain carbohydrates (carbs), including: Fruit and fruit juice. Cereal, bread, pasta, and rice. Milk and milk products, soy milk. Beans, legumes, and lentils. Starchy vegetables like potatoes and corn. Sweets like cookies, candy, cake, jam and jelly, honey, and other foods that contain added sugar.
